Malcolm for Model Number NGP745UC/01 I have a Bosch Natural Gas 4 burner cooktop (NGP745UC/01) that I recently installed. Three of the 4 burners light with no problem, however the 4th burner, the lower right (with simmer) that would be used the most, has good spark but will not light. Additionally, that same lower right burner sparks when any of the other three burners are turned on. From reading other posts it would appear the spark switch for that lower right burner needs to be replaced, however the sparking on that burner when not turned on doesn't seem to fit any of the other diagnosis. Answer Malcolm, Based on the information provided I would start by checking to see if the burner lights with a match or lighter. If it does then check the burner holes near the ignitor to make sure nothing is plugged or stopped up. If that is not it then check the gas and air adjustments.If it does not light with a match or lighter then check the gas valve for that burner. Read More...
